- •Block Reference
- •Commonly Used
- •Continuous
- •Discontinuities
- •Discrete
- •Logic and Bit Operations
- •Lookup Tables
- •Math Operations
- •Model Verification
- •Model-Wide Utilities
- •Ports & Subsystems
- •Signal Attributes
- •Signal Routing
- •Sinks
- •Sources
- •User-Defined Functions
- •Additional Math & Discrete
- •Additional Discrete
- •Additional Math: Increment — Decrement
- •Run on Target Hardware
- •Target for Use with Arduino Hardware
- •Target for Use with BeagleBoard Hardware
- •Target for Use with LEGO MINDSTORMS NXT Hardware
- •Blocks — Alphabetical List
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Settings Pane
- •Measurements Pane
- •Signal Statistics Measurements
- •Settings Pane
- •Transitions Pane
- •Overshoots/Undershoots
- •Cycles
- •Settings Pane
- •Peaks Pane
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Command-Line Information
- •Function Reference
- •Model Construction
- •Simulation
- •Linearization and Trimming
- •Data Type
- •Examples
- •Main Toolbar
- •Command-Line Alternative
- •Command-Line Alternative
- •Command-Line Alternative
- •Command-Line Alternative
- •Command-Line Alternative
- •Command-Line Alternative
- •Mask Icon Drawing Commands
- •Simulink Classes
- •Model Parameters
- •About Model Parameters
- •Examples of Setting Model Parameters
- •Common Block Parameters
- •About Common Block Parameters
- •Examples of Setting Block Parameters
- •Block-Specific Parameters
- •Mask Parameters
- •About Mask Parameters
- •Notes on Mask Parameter Storage
- •Simulink Identifier
- •Simulink Identifier
- •Model Advisor Checks
- •Simulink Checks
- •Simulink Check Overview
- •See Also
- •Identify unconnected lines, input ports, and output ports
- •Description
- •Results and Recommended Actions
- •Capabilities and Limitations
- •Tips
- •See Also
- •Check root model Inport block specifications
- •Description
- •Results and Recommended Actions
- •See Also
- •Check optimization settings
- •Description
- •Results and Recommended Actions
- •Tips
- •See Also
- •Description
- •Results and Recommended Actions
- •See Also
- •Check for implicit signal resolution
- •Description
- •Results and Recommended Actions
- •See Also
- •Check for optimal bus virtuality
- •Description
- •Results and Recommended Actions
- •Capabilities and Limitations
- •See Also
- •Description
- •Results and Recommended Actions
- •Capabilities and Limitations
- •See Also
- •Identify disabled library links
- •Description
- •Results and Recommended Actions
- •Capabilities and Limitations
- •Tips
- •See Also
- •Identify parameterized library links
- •Description
- •Results and Recommended Actions
- •Capabilities and Limitations
- •Tips
- •See Also
- •Identify unresolved library links
- •Description
- •Results and Recommended Actions
- •Capabilities and Limitations
- •See Also
- •Results and Recommended Actions
- •Capabilities and Limitations
- •See Also
- •Results and Recommended Actions
- •Capabilities and Limitations
- •See Also
- •Check usage of function-call connections
- •Description
- •Results and Recommended Actions
- •See Also
- •Check signal logging save format
- •Description
- •Results and Recommended Actions
- •See Also
- •Description
- •Results and Recommended Actions
- •See Also
- •Description
- •Results and Recommended Actions
- •Tips
- •See Also
- •Check data store block sample times for modeling errors
- •Description
- •Results and Recommended Actions
- •See Also
- •Check for potential ordering issues involving data store access
- •Description
- •Results and Recommended Actions
- •Tips
- •See Also
- •Check for partial structure parameter usage with bus signals
- •Description
- •Results and Recommended Actions
- •Tips
- •See Also
- •Check for calls to slDataTypeAndScale
- •Description
- •Results and Recommended Actions
- •Tips
- •See Also
- •Check for proper bus usage
- •Description
- •Results and Recommended Actions
- •Action Results
- •Tips
- •See Also
- •Description
- •Results and Recommended Actions
- •See Also
- •Description
- •Results and Recommended Actions
- •See Also
- •Check for proper Merge block usage
- •Description
- •Input Parameters
- •Results and Recommended Actions
- •See Also
- •Description
- •Results and Recommended Actions
- •Action Results
- •See Also
- •Check for non-continuous signals driving derivative ports
- •Description
- •Results and Recommended Actions
- •See Also
- •Runtime diagnostics for S-functions
- •Description
- •Results and Recommended Actions
- •See Also
- •Check file for foreign characters
- •Description
- •Results and Recommended Actions
- •Tips
- •See Also
- •Check model for known block upgrade issues
- •Description
- •Results and Recommended Actions
- •Action Results
- •See Also
- •Description
- •Results and Recommended Actions
- •Action Results
- •See Also
- •Check that the model is saved in SLX format
- •Description
- •Results and Recommended Actions
- •Tips
- •See Also
- •Check Model History properties
- •Description
- •Results and Recommended Actions
- •See Also
- •Analyze model hierarchy for upgrade issues
- •Description
- •Results and Recommended Actions
- •Tips
- •See Also
- •Description
- •Results and Recommended Actions
- •See Also
- •Simulink Performance Advisor Checks
- •Simulink Performance Advisor Check Overview
- •See Also
- •Baseline
- •See Also
- •Check Preupdate Items
- •See Also
- •Checks that need Update Diagram
- •See Also
- •Checks that require simulation to run
- •See Also
- •Check Accelerator Settings
- •See Also
- •Create Baseline
- •See Also
- •Identify resource intensive diagnostic settings
- •See Also
- •Check optimization settings
- •See Also
- •Identify inefficient lookup table blocks
- •See Also
- •Identify Interpreted MATLAB Function blocks
- •See Also
- •Check MATLAB Function block debug settings
- •See Also
- •Check Stateflow block debug settings
- •See Also
- •Identify simulation target settings
- •See Also
- •Check model reference rebuild setting
- •See Also
- •Check Model Reference parallel build
- •See Also
- •Check solver type selection
- •See Also
- •Select normal or accelerator simulation mode
- •See Also
- •Simulink Limits
- •Maximum Size Limits of Simulink Models
- •Index
- •Filter Structures and Filter Coefficients
- •Valid Initial States
- •Number of Delay Elements (Filter States)
- •Frame-Based Processing
- •Sample-Based Processing
- •Valid Initial States
- •Frame-Based Processing
- •Sample-Based Processing
- •Model Parameters in Alphabetical Order
- •Common Block Parameters
- •Continuous Library Block Parameters
- •Discontinuities Library Block Parameters
- •Discrete Library Block Parameters
- •Logic and Bit Operations Library Block Parameters
- •Lookup Tables Block Parameters
- •Math Operations Library Block Parameters
- •Model Verification Library Block Parameters
- •Model-Wide Utilities Library Block Parameters
- •Ports & Subsystems Library Block Parameters
- •Signal Attributes Library Block Parameters
- •Signal Routing Library Block Parameters
- •Sinks Library Block Parameters
- •Sources Library Block Parameters
- •User-Defined Functions Library Block Parameters
- •Additional Discrete Block Library Parameters
- •Additional Math: Increment - Decrement Block Parameters
- •Mask Parameters
1 Block Reference
Run on Target Hardware
Target for Use with Arduino |
Generate applications for Arduino® |
Hardware (p. 1-24) |
hardware |
Target for Use with BeagleBoard |
Generate applications for |
Hardware (p. 1-25) |
BeagleBoard™ hardware |
Target for Use with LEGO |
Generate applications for LEGO® |
MINDSTORMS NXT Hardware |
MINDSTORMS® NXT™ hardware |
(p. 1-26) |
|
Target for Use with Arduino Hardware
Arduino Analog Input
Arduino Continuous Servo Write
Arduino Digital Input
Arduino Digital Output
Arduino PWM
Arduino Serial Receive
Arduino Serial Transmit
Arduino Standard Servo Read
Arduino Standard Servo Write
targetinstaller
Measure voltage of analog input pin
Set shaft speed of continuous rotation servo motor
Get logical value of digital input pin Set logical value of digital output pin
Generate PWM waveform on analog output pin
Get one byte of data from serial port Send buffered data to serial port
Get position of standard servo motor shaft in degrees
Set shaft position of standard servo motor
Open Target Installer and install support for third-party hardware or software
1-24
Run on Target Hardware
Target for Use with BeagleBoard Hardware
BeagleBoard ALSA Audio Capture
BeagleBoard ALSA Audio
Playback
BeagleBoard SDL Video Display
BeagleBoard UDP Receive
BeagleBoard UDP Send
BeagleBoard V4L2 Video Capture
PandaBoard ALSA Audio Capture
PandaBoard ALSA Audio Playback
PandaBoard SDL Video Display
PandaBoard UDP Receive
PandaBoard UDP Send
PandaBoard V4L2 Video Capture
targetinstaller
targetupdater
Capture audio from sound card using ALSA
Send audio to sound card for playback using ALSA
Display video using SDL
Receive UDP packets over IP network
Send UDP packets over IP network
Capture video from USB camera using V4L2
Capture audio from sound card using ALSA
Send audio to sound card for playback using ALSA
Display video using SDL
Receive UDP packets over IP network
Send UDP packets over IP network
Capture video from USB camera using V4L2
Open Target Installer and install support for third-party hardware or software
Open Target Installer and update firmware on third-party hardware
1-25
1 Block Reference
Target for Use with LEGO MINDSTORMS NXT Hardware
LEGO MINDSTORMS NXT
Acceleration Sensor
LEGO MINDSTORMS NXT Battery
LEGO MINDSTORMS NXT Button
LEGO MINDSTORMS NXT Color
Sensor
LEGO MINDSTORMS NXT Encoder
LEGO MINDSTORMS NXT Gyro
Sensor
LEGO MINDSTORMS NXT LCD
LEGO MINDSTORMS NXT Light
Sensor
LEGO MINDSTORMS NXT Motor
LEGO MINDSTORMS NXT Receive via Bluetooth Connection
LEGO MINDSTORMS NXT Send via Bluetooth Connection
LEGO MINDSTORMS NXT Sound
Sensor
LEGO MINDSTORMS NXT Speaker
LEGO MINDSTORMS NXT Timer
LEGO MINDSTORMS NXT Touch
Sensor
LEGO MINDSTORMS NXT Ultrasonic
Sensor
Measure acceleration along three axes
Measure voltage of battery in NXT brick
Output state of button on NXT brick Measure color or light intensity
Measure encoder rotation from NXT Interactive Servo Motor
Measure rate of rotation
Display number on single line of NXT LCD screen
Measure light intensity
Set motor speed and stopping action
Receive data from another NXT brick over Bluetooth®
Send data to another NXT brick over Bluetooth
Measure sound level
Play tones on speaker in NXT brick
Measure elapsed time from timer in NXT brick
Output state of touch sensor
Measure distance from object in centimeters
1-26
Run on Target Hardware
targetinstaller |
Open Target Installer and install |
|
support for third-party hardware or |
|
software |
targetupdater |
Open Target Installer and update |
|
firmware on third-party hardware |
1-27
1 Block Reference
1-28